Abstract

This study aims to analyze the effect of using limestone powder as a partial replacement for cement on the slump value of flowing concrete. The limestone powder substitution was applied in variations of 0%, 5%, 9%, 10%, and 15% of the cement weight to observe changes in the fresh properties of the concrete. The slump test was carried out according to standard methods for flowing concrete to evaluate the workability and flowability of the mixture. The test results showed that the addition of limestone powder with fine particle size was able to increase the slump value because it acts as a filler that improves particle packing and reduces inter-particle friction. However, at substitution levels above the optimum limit, a tendency for segregation began to appear, resulting in reduced mixture stability. Overall, limestone powder can be used as a cement substitute in flowing concrete as long as its percentage is controlled to ensure it still meets the required workability standards.
